6. Tighten all 8 nuts until the proper spring height dimension values are achieved per the PTO
Shaft Clutch Spring Height vs. Horsepower table for your PTO output horsepower. It is
recommended that a calliper (either digital, dial, or vernier—similar to the one shown below)
be used to accurately verify the spring height measurements. After setting all 8 spring
heights, the clutch is now ready for use.
PTO Shaft Clutch Spring Height vs. Horsepower
PTO Shaft Clutch Flange Dia PTO hp Spring Height
5S.FF2
7- (200 mm)
20 hp
1.26” (31.9 mm)
25 hp
1.25” (31.7 mm)
30 hp
1.24” (31.4 mm)
35 hp
1.22” (31.1 mm)
45 hp
1.20” (30.5 mm)
All ratings are at 540 rpm PTO speed
7. The clutch should be checked during the first hour of use and periodically each week
thereafter. Excessive clutch plate slippage, burning odor, or visible smoking should not be
observed during use.
